morrow making me remember why i was hesitant to even give him up in those mayo rumors last year... hes just a flat out historical shooter. did a good job punishing inside the arc when they put little guys on him too
stevenson with another great peformance, the man's our starting 3 and thank god james got injured so avery could get that. great defender (his strength and quickness really gave demar trouble tonight), a very, very smart passer, can bring the ball up court, and hes killing it from deep. he knows how to rotate the ball crisply and immediately understands where the open shot is, two debilitating faults in damion jame's game.
farmar... props to him on a damn good game. excellent defensively, penetrated and kicked, and made some shots. looked really good playing alongside d-will.
hump played angry tonight.
d-will with his best game of the year. jesus he was murdering dudes with his crossover tonight
were a pretty damn tough team when we have d-will, stevenson, and hump out there together. this team has shooters... if we can find a rhythm with penetrators like deron, farmar, and marshon, we have a chance to at least be pretty respectable.
